Over the past few years, Jimi Somewhere has easily become one of our favorite indie artists out there. Having continued to grow in leaps and bounds with every release, the 21-year-old Norwegian phenom has offered up the second single from his forthcoming album today with “Jesus” (feat. Kacy Hill).
Driven to show listeners the innermost workings of his heart and mind, Jimi has been blessed with a knack for crafting songs that pull you directly into his melancholic yet elated sonic world. And following up his past two releases “Selfish” & “Bottle Rocket“, this latest offering expands upon his already impressive catalog, embodying the deep sadness found in confusion and longing to feel like you belong.
Graced with the immaculate additional vocals of Kacy Hill, “Jesus” shows an incredible vulnerability we’ve come to love from Jimi, and hope to hear a lot more of on his new album. Stream it below and enjoy!
